Details

This Carefree Buffalo Spearpoint Exclusive Edition ‘Humble Pride’ Pocket Knife features a Beautiful and Rare Historical Wood of America scale from 1 of the 13 Horse Chestnut Trees planted in mid-1788 by George Washington in Fredericksburg, Virginia at his mothers house to provide shade and to Commemorate the New Thirteen States. The frame is hand-forged ‘Twist' Damascus by Chad Nichols.  The blade is hand-forged ‘Flag' Damascus by Chad Nichols.  The one-hand button lock, thumb stud and lanyard beads are all set with smokey quartz gemstones.

 

Designed and Made Exclusively for Carefree Buffalo in Jacksonville Oregon in Commemoration of the United States of America’s 250th Anniversary on July 4, 2026.
